Les Rolston to talk about latest book ‘A Pea Coat Goes Home’

Posted

Join Warwick author Les Rolston for a talk about his latest book, A Pea Coat Goes Home, on Tuesday, February 23 at 7 p.m.

Follow the story of the 70-year-old pea coat that Les and his father shared throughout their lives. Surviving a war, worn during a marriage proposal, and handed down to a son, the jacket at last returns to the ship where Les’ father served during World War II.

Les is the author of Home of the Brave, Long Time Gone and Lost Soul, which received the Jefferson Davis Medal from the United Daughters of the Confederacy and a commendation from former United States Senator Claiborne Pell.
